Duplicated typescript, undated, of 'Jonet Douglas. A historical play of the reign of James V, of Scotland’ by Edith Anne Robertson., Early 20th century-3rd quarter of 20th century.
Educated in Glasgow and Germany, in 1919 Edith Anne married James A Robertson who became Professor of Biblical Criticism at Aberdeen University. Her publications included a life of St Francis Xavier as well as poems in English and Scots.

Duplicated typescript with manuscript revisions for the television production of ‘Young Auchinleck’ by Robert McLellan., 1965.
The revisions are not in Robert McLellan's hand. Act I, scene 1 is omitted, since it was not included in the televised version.
Duplicated typescripts of 'Blood upon the Rose: a play in three acts' by George Moncrieff-Scott, with annotations, probably used in the production of the play at the Edinburgh Festival in 1957., [?1956.]
George Scott-Moncrieff wrote a number of plays, of which only ‘Fotheringhay’ was published (Edinburgh, 1953), although others were performed on the stage or broadcast. Most of the surviving typescripts are undated.

Duplicates of official dispatches of Sir Charles Elliot, H M Plenipotentiary in China concerning negotiations with Chinese officials about trade and territorial concessions at Hong Kong, the breakdown of these negotiations, and the resumption of hostilities., 1841.
